摘要:
文章目录一、错误的核心:调用者到底需要知道什么?错误示例:不区分错误来源正确示例:枚举错误来源二、错误信息越多不代表更好过度设计的灾难实用设计:擦除无关信息三、特殊情况是设计的失败错误示例:用 Option 偷懒正确示例:用 Result 明确语义四、操作符不是魔法,是糖衣错误示例:只实现了 Int 阅读全文
posted @ 2025-11-15 08:54
yangykaifa
阅读(15)
评论(0)
推荐(0)
摘要:
文章目录1. 什么是分布式锁?2. 分布式锁的基本实现3. 引入过期时间4. 引入校验ID5. 引入Lua6. 引入看门狗(Watch Dog)7. 引入Redlock算法特此注明 : Designed By :长安城没有风 Version:1.0Time:2025.10.19 Location:辽 阅读全文
posted @ 2025-11-15 08:25
yangykaifa
阅读(15)
评论(0)
推荐(0)
摘要:
深入剖析Java 23种设计模式:从入门到精通设计模式概述设计模式(Design Pattern)是一套被反复使用、多数人知晓、经过分类编目的、代码设计经验的总结。它的核心目的是为了实现代码的可重用性,让代码更易于被他人理解,同时保证代码的可靠性,使代码编写真正工程化,堪称软件工程的基石脉络。设计模 阅读全文
posted @ 2025-11-15 08:05
yangykaifa
阅读(61)
评论(0)
推荐(0)

浙公网安备 33010602011771号